Local Transport in Phu Quoc Island
Getting around on Phu Quoc Island mostly requires the use of motorised vehicles as the island is still relatively undeveloped and roads outside the main town of Duong Dong can get rather bumpy (and muddy during the monsoon season). WEATHER & CLIMATE
Thanks to the location embraced by the ocean, Phu Quoc has temperate weather. The average temperature ranges from 26oC to 28oC. The highest daytime temperature in Phu Quoc is up to 32oC and the lowest one recorded in recent times is 15.7oC.
